Transportation in Columbus
Just a one-day drive or one-hour flight from nearly half of the U.S. population, John Glenn International Airport is just 10 minutes from downtown. Whether you prefer transportation that is on demand, on a fixed route, or on your own schedule, getting to and around Columbus is easy and accessible.

BY BUS
Central Ohio Transit Authority (COTA)
With over 40 fixed-route lines and 4 on-demand service zones, COTA is the primary bus provider for Greater Columbus.
